1. A self-propelled device comprising:

  • a substantially cylindrical body;

    a drive system comprising a carrier, a left motor to operate a left wheel, a right motor to operate a right wheel, and one or more power units to power the left and right motors, wherein the left motor and the right motor are each mounted to hang freely from the carrier between the left and right wheels and below a common rotational axis of both the left and right wheels;

    a receiver coupled to the carrier to receive control inputs from a mobile computing device; and

    a processor coupled to the circuit board to;

    in response to execution of a software application on the mobile computing device, establish a wireless communication link with the mobile computing device to receive, via the receiver, the control inputs; and

    process the control inputs for maneuvering the self-propelled device by independently operating the left motor and the right motor;

    wherein actuation of the left motor and the right motor by the processor causes the left and right motors, hanging freely from the carrier, to pitch rotationally, causing a displacement in the center of mass of the self-propelled device in order to propel the self-propelled device.
